小编yar*_*den的帖子

节点webkit-从父窗口捕获iframe鼠标事件

我正在尝试在我的应用中创建一个可拖动的iframe.当iframe被聚焦时,所有鼠标事件都在内部窗口对象中触发.

  • 我无法在iframe中收听这些事件并自行触发它们,因为它可以被iframe内容js阻止
  • 我无法在iframe上创建一个不可见的层来捕获所有事件并将它们移动到iframe,因为bultin事件不能由脚本触发(如css hover)
  • 我可以在不使用webkit DOM的情况下在Node层中捕获这些事件吗?

javascript iframe node.js node-webkit

10
推荐指数
1
解决办法
704
查看次数

如果 React 中的变量==某物,如何将类分配给元素?

我是 React 新手,之前经常使用 Angular。在 Angular 中,根据变量分配一些类是尽可能简单的,如下所示:

<p ng-class="{warning: warningLevel==3, critical: warningLevel==5}">Mars attacks!</p>
Run Code Online (Sandbox Code Playgroud)

我如何使用 React 在模板中做类似的事情?

html javascript reactjs

5
推荐指数
2
解决办法
8575
查看次数

迭代哈希打印哈希?

我在Ruby中迭代了一堆嵌套的哈希:

@data.each do |key, value|
    puts "Key: #{key}"
    puts "Value: #{value}"
end
Run Code Online (Sandbox Code Playgroud)

与输出:

Key: 1.0
Value: {"label"=>"Default Label"}
{"1.0"=>{"label"=>"Default Label"}}
Run Code Online (Sandbox Code Playgroud)

现在我真的不明白为什么打印最后一行.当我从循环中删除两个"puts"调用时,它甚至会被打印出来.我试图在网上找到一些关于这种行为,但找不到任何东西.我可以用任何方式防止这种情况发生吗?或者我误解了哈希的"每个"调用?

ruby hash

-1
推荐指数
1
解决办法
56
查看次数

标签 统计

javascript ×2

hash ×1

html ×1

iframe ×1

node-webkit ×1

node.js ×1

reactjs ×1

ruby ×1